73388 - Digital Systems M

Academic Year 2017/2018

  • Docente: Giovanni Neri
  • Credits: 6
  • SSD: ING-INF/05
  • Language: English
  • Teaching Mode: Traditional lectures
  • Campus: Bologna
  • Corso: Second cycle degree programme (LM) in Telecommunications Engineering (cod. 9205)

Learning outcomes

At the end of this course, the student will be able to directly design and implement simple synchronous and asynchronous logical networks. They will also know how to use computer assisted programs for designing, partitioning and simulating complex digital systems using VHDL language. They will have also a good knowledge of the problems arising from the real behaviour of the digital devices.

Course contents

Combinatorial networks: Boole algebra, truth tables, canonical forms, minimization, Karnaugh maps. Asynchronous networks: formal synthesis, minimization, direct synthesis. Synchronous networks: formal synthesis, minimization, register, counters, shift registers. VHDL. Use of Xilinx Vivado synthesis system

Readings/Bibliography

None

Teaching methods

Lectures. The lectures are broadcasted in real time in Internet, recorded and made available in http//gneri.deis.unibo.it where the student can find the course slides too.

Assessment methods

The exam consists of a written test followed by an oral examination if the written test is passed. The written test (2 hours) consists of 3/4 questions related to the program of the course which can be either simple exercises or answers to specific questions. The oral exam (which is held on the same day) consists of questions about all subjects of the course. If the written test is not passed no notice is taken. The oral exam on the contrary is any case registered no matter whether passed or not passed. If not passed the written exam must be repeated in the next session. The written exam is valid only for the current date. No cell phones, tablet, notes etc. are allowed. Before attending the exam the student must implement a VHDL project which must agreed upon with the professor.

Teaching tools

See http://gneri.deis.unibo.it

Links to further information

http://gneri.deis.unibo.it

Office hours

See the website of Giovanni Neri